分享

在excel中,要如何方便快捷的截取单元格中自己想要的内容?

 xacaowei55 2019-05-16

一、常用的截取字符串函数

在Excel中,使用Left Right Mid 几个函数,即可截取所需的内容。

函数用法:

=Left( 单元格, 从左向右截取几个字符 )

=Right( 单元格, 从右向左截取几个字符 )

=Mid( 单元格, 从那个字符开始, 从左向右截取几个字符 )

如下所示,从身份证号中,提取出生日期,就是使用公式:=MID(A1,7,8)

若,数据源不规则,那,还可以配合Len或者Find函数使用

=Len(字符串),返回字符串的长度;

=Find(查找的字符串, 在哪里找, 从哪个位置开始),返回找到的文本位置;

如下示例,使用Len函数返回身份证号的长度,使用Find函数查找“19”出现的位置:

通过以上的几个字符串函数,基本上能搞定日常工作中的各种单元格内容截取。

二、数据分列

截取单元格内容,数据分列,是一个非常好用的工具。

通过分列功能,我们可以截取固定长度或者带有分隔符内容,使用方法也很简单。

还是如上的身份证号中提取生日,使用分列功能,不用输入任何公式,动动鼠标,就能轻松搞定,如下所示:

再如,职场中,从其他系统导出的数据(通常带有分隔符,如空格,逗号,分号等),分列功能尤为好用。

三、快速填充

新版本Excel中,新增了“快速填充”功能,快捷是<Ctrl>+E。

这个功能,对于从字符串中获取有一定规律的内容,很是好用,甚至比分列功能还好用!

还是在身份证号提取生日实例,如下所示:

    本站是提供个人知识管理的网络存储空间,所有内容均由用户发布,不代表本站观点。请注意甄别内容中的联系方式、诱导购买等信息,谨防诈骗。如发现有害或侵权内容,请点击一键举报。
    转藏 分享 献花(0

    0条评论

    发表

    请遵守用户 评论公约

    类似文章 更多